An Active License

If you’ve gotten this far, you’re probably already aware that every agent must be sponsored by a Texas real estate brokerage. It’s the law. At least, it’s a requirement for anyone who wants to have an active license anyway. Technically you don’t need to have a sponsoring broker if you’re okay with having an inactive license.
